In Which Process Do Plants Release Oxygen. All aerobic organisms use free oxygen for respiration. Plants must inhale carbon dioxide using sunlight because the carbon atoms are a source of building sugar, proteins, and nucleotides. In other words, while we inhale oxygen and exhale carbon dioxide, plants inhale carbon dioxide and exhale oxygen. Hopefully you can see that plants and the process that makes oxygen is important for the plant, but also for humans and other animals as well!
